Problem is, I can only reach about 3' from each end of the row to pull
them up - there is therefore a 2' section of most rows that I cant get
to! I dont want to stand on the soil as I will compact it (spent ages
cultivating it - fairly high clay content in a new build garden).
If you don't want to walk on the cultivated soil, then I suggest a move
from 'traditional' rows, to a bed system (they don't have to be
'raised') with beds 4-5 feet wide you can reach from paths each side.
Or should I not be so anal and just leave the weeds growing until the
veg is established enough and I'm not so concerned about disturbing the
soil ?
No, bad plan, the bigger the weeds, the harder work it is to be rid of
them.
